Expressing the sense of the Senate that climate change is real and that the National Science Foundation should engage on the communication of sound climate change science to the public.

S. Res. 573 · 115th Congress · Jul 12, 2018 · Lineage

RESOLUTION

That it is the sense of the Senate that—
(1)
climate change is real and human activity is the main driver of modern climate change;
(2)
the scientific consensus on climate change and the implications of climate change with respect to the increase in the frequency and severity of extreme weather makes it in the public interest that broadcast meteorologists knowledgeably communicate scientifically based climate information to the public;
(3)
fossil fuel companies, both directly and through their trade associations, public relations firms, and foundations, should cease their misinformation campaigns concerning the dangers of climate change; and
(4)
it is within the authority and aligned with the mission of the National Science Foundation to provide grants to broadcast meteorologists to improve their understanding of climate change science and ability to communicate climate change science to the public.
